Hillcroft Services is seeking a Residential Site Manager to lead daily operations in a Continuous Supports residential setting serving individ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ist individuals to access the community to lead a fully integrated and independent life
- Support individuals with essential life skills in the home such as cooking, cleaning, and medication management
- Promote a healthy lifestyle incorporating recreational activities and social gatherings
- Supervise, train, schedule, and support DSP staff
- Oversee daily residential operations and ensure compliance with PCISPs, Medicaid, and agency standards
- Review documentation, medication records, and staff timesheets
- Coordinate staffing coverage, appointments, transportation, and household needs
- Facilitate life skills, academic, and community‑based supports
- Conduct emergency drills, staff meetings, and performance reviews
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ent (required)
- Experience working with individuals with ID/DD (paid or volunteer)
- Supervisory experience preferred
- Strong communication and basic computer skills
- Valid Indiana driver’s license and reliable, insured vehicle
- Ability to pass background checks and required trainings (CPR/First Aid, Medication Administration)
Physical & Schedule Requirements:
- Ability to lift up to 25 lbs and assist with transfers
- Ability to work weekends and overtime as needed
